Form 4: Cyanotech Director Michael Davis Increases Stake in Company
SEC Form 4
Director Michael Davis reports purchasing additional shares of Cyanotech Corp through a revocable trust.
Summary
- On September 23 and 24, 2024, Michael Davis, a director and 10% owner of Cyanotech Corporation, acquired 5,000 shares each day at prices of $0.77 and $0.73 respectively.
- These purchases were made under a pre-arranged 10b5-1(c) plan adopted on March 6, 2024.
- Following these transactions, Davis beneficially owns 1,440,440 shares through a revocable trust, along with other shares held directly, by his spouse, and through other trusts.
